WebStep 1: Determine the primary (or main) disorder—whether it is metabolic or respiratory—from blood pH, HCO 3–, and P CO2 values. Step 2: Determine the presence of mixed acid-base disorders by calculating the range of compensatory responses (see Table 21–11 ). WebA mixed disturbance is more than one primary disturbance (not a primary with an expected compensatory response). Acid-base disturbances have profound effects on the body. Acidemia results in arrhythmia, decreased cardiac output, depression, and bone demineralization. WebAug 21, 2016 · A mixed acid-base disturbance is characterized by the presence of two or more separate primary acid-base abnormalities occurring in the same patient. An acid-base disturbance is said to be simple if it is limited to the primary disturbance and the expected compensatory response.
